Gary Lineker has been taken off Match of the Day duties at the BBC – but what has actually happened?

“This is just an immeasurably cruel policy directed at the most vulnerable people in language that is not dissimilar to that used by Germany in the 30s, and I’m out of order?”Lineker’s tweet appears to have annoyed the Conservative Party, largely, while particular offence has been taken with his 1930s Germany comparison.Tory party deputy chairman Lee Anderson said: “This is just another example of how out of touch these overpaid stars are with the voting public.

And Braverman responded by saying: “I’m disappointed, obviously. I think it’s unhelpful to compare our measures, which are lawful, proportionate and – indeed – compassionate, to 1930s Germany. I also think that we are on the side of the British people here.”How has the BBC responded? A spokesperson for the corporation said at the time: “The BBC has social media guidance, which is published. Individuals who work for us are aware of their responsibilities relating to social media. We have appropriate internal processes in place if required.BBC Director-General Tim Davie has insisted he has prioritised impartiality at the corporation
